Alert: ws-reconnect-storm

The Pondermesh gateway is seeing clients stuck in a reconnect loop after the v4.2 rollout; sessions drop roughly every 90 seconds and hammer the handshake endpoint. This matches the known reconnect bug tracked for the next patch release. Rollback criteria, affected build numbers, and the current mitigation status are maintained on the internal page.

wiki page, tahaf-tajog: https://jira.ordindyn.corp/pipeline

The Crashfall pipeline ingests crash reports from the Murmura mobile app, strips device identifiers at the Veilgate scrubber, and forwards sanitized payloads to the Ossuary archive in the Brinmark region. Each stage logs to an append-only audit stream. Before replaying any failed batch, confirm the scrubber version matches production. Replay jobs authenticate against the internal Ossuary service with the key shown below.

app token of badug-tahaf = qvz11-nP5FBNr8qnh

Handover: Exportron retry queue

Hi Mira — handing over the failed-export retries. Exports that hit a timeout land in the retry queue and get three attempts with backoff; after that they're parked and need a manual requeue from the admin panel. Watch for customers reporting duplicates — that usually means a double requeue. The current retry settings are as follows.

settings of bajog-fawig:
oliael:
  log_level: warn
  metrics_host: metrics.oliael.zemvarsys.internal
  pin: 0267
  pool_size: 32

Restricted: managers only.

We are running a twelve-week pilot placing Novari kiosks in eight Bramleigh locations across the Eastvale region. Bramleigh handles staffing; we supply hardware, training, and remote support. Success metrics: transactions per kiosk per day, basket uplift, and fault rate under 2%. Weekly reviews run Thursdays with the Bramleigh operations lead. Heads of department should prepare resourcing estimates for a full rollout scenario. The pilot's broader purpose is confidential and is recorded in the note directly below.

board note of kageg-bahof: The renewal with Holwynax Holdings closes at $2 million a year, 5 percent below the last contract. Project Ulaath slips by two quarters because of the supplier delay.